Step-by-step explanation:
The given cylinder has a height of 2r, so its volume is ...
V = πr²(2r) = 2πr³
The volume of a sphere is given by ...
V = 4/3πr³
Then the ratio of the volume of the sphere to the volume of the cylinder is ...
(4/3πr³)/(2πr³) = (4/3)/2 = 2/3
So, the volume of the sphere is 2/3 times the volume of the cylinder:

Step-by-step explanation:
This is an even polynomial because both ends end up. This means the degree of the polynomial is even. This means b and c are not solutions since their degrees are odd.
To determine between A and D look at the x-intercepts. The x-intercepts of a polynomial graph have a special relationship with its equation. The x-intercepts are the solutions or roots of the factors. This means that when each factor is set equal to 0 and solved, its solution is an x-intercept. Here the x-intercepts are x = -1, 0,3. This means the factors are x(x+1)(x-3).
Notice at x = -1, the function touches but does not cross? This means the factor has an even exponent on it.
So the expression is likely x(x+1)^2 (x-3).
Since only one factor has an exponent, the answer is A.
